A useful formula for finding the effective rate on discounted notes is
.. (effective rate) = r/(1 -rt)
If we assume a 52-week year, the t = (13 weeks)/(52 weeks) = 1/4.
.. (effective rate) = 0.0385/(1 -0.0385/4) ≈ 0.038874 ≈ 3.89%
What if I write the equation like this:
y = zero x - 3.
Now you know that the slope of the line is zero and its y-intercept is -3.
That's a horizontal line that crosses the y-axis at -3. And just like the equation says, the value of 'y' doesn't depend on 'x'. It's -3 everywhere.

2(2x - 5) = 3x + x - 2x
Distribute the 2.
4x - 10 = 3x + x - 2x
Combine like terms.
4x - 10 = 2x
Subtract 4x from both sides.
-10 = -2x
Divide by -2.
5 = x
x = 5
